Brigitte Hall is a London-based freelance English - French translator, interpreter and tutor with over 30 years experience.

Brigitte was born in Paris but has lived in London most of her adult life with her British husband and two children.

She has a Masters in Translation Studies and a Diploma in Public Services Interpretation.

She has been a Lecturer of French Translation at both Middlesex University and Birkbeck College, University of London.

As an approved interpreter and translator for the French Consulate in London, Brigitte has years of translation and interpreting experience across a vast number of sectors – including law, health, tourism and sport, to name a few.

Brigitte is a member of CIOL (Chartered Institute of Linguists) and NRPSI (National Register of Public Services Interpreters).
